THIRUVANANTHAPURAM: C K Lukose, politburo member of SUCI and all India vice-president AIUTUC, died here on Wednesday.
Lukose, 71, had Parkinson’s disease and was undergoing treatment for the past few months. He breathed his last at the Medical College Hospital by 6.30am on Wednesday.
Lukose was born in Piravom in Ernakulam. He was attracted to SUCI while studying for engineering in TKM College, Kollam.
For several years, he served as Kollam district secretary of SUCI.
In 1988, he was selected as the state secretary of SUCI. During his tenure, Lukose tried to organise people’s resistance campaigns across the state against capitalist policies followed by governments.
His body will be kept for public homage at SUCI Centre, Law College Junction from 10am to 1pm on Thursday. Cremation will be held at 2pm at Santhi Kavadam.
Lukose leaves behind wife Lalitha Mathew, son Sekhar Lukose Kuriakose (member secretary, state disaster management authority) and daughter Ammu Lukose. National leaders of SUCI Radhakrishna and Souman Bose will reach here on Thursday to pay homage to Lukose. tnn
